1.19 Lakh Vacant Posts in Rajasthan Education Department

The Rajasthan Education Department is confronting a significant staffing crisis, with over 1.19 lakh positions currently vacant across schools, colleges, and administrative departments. This report provides a detailed breakdown of these vacancies, their influence on academic quality, and the status of upcoming 2025 recruitment drives. Official data from the Directorate of Secondary Education indicates that out of 4,10,351 total sanctioned posts, only 2,91,075 are currently occupied.

Latest Update on Rajasthan Teaching Recruitment 2025

To mitigate this staffing deficit, the Rajasthan state government has fast-tracked several recruitment initiatives. Both the Rajasthan Public Service Commission (RPSC) and the Rajasthan Staff Selection Board (RSSB) have issued strategic notifications this year to begin filling these critical teaching roles.

  • RPSC Senior Teacher Recruitment 2025: 6,500 vacancies
  • RPSC School Lecturer (1st Grade Teacher): 3,225 posts
  • REET Mains 2025 (Level 1 & 2 Teachers): 7,759 vacancies

Category-Wise Vacancy Status in Rajasthan Education Department

The following table provides a comprehensive, category-wise breakdown of the sanctioned, active, and vacant positions within the department:

Category Sanctioned Posts Working Staff Vacant Posts
Senior Teacher 1,09,873 68,022 41,851
Principal & Equivalent 19,278 12,971 6,307
Vice Principal 12,404 4,960 7,444
Computer Instructor 11,039 9,444 1,595
Laboratory Assistant 5,581 4,109 1,472
Junior Assistant 13,314 6,991 6,323
Class IV Employee 29,631 24,576 5,205
Total 4,10,351 2,91,075 1,19,276

Shortage of Teachers Affects Learning Quality

Academic institutions across the state are under pressure due to these persistent teaching shortages. The Senior Teacher category is particularly affected, with approximately 38% of positions currently unfilled. This imbalance often forces educators to manage multiple subjects, significantly increasing their workload and undermining the quality of student instruction.

Education experts highlight that these vacancies directly disrupt the teacher-student ratio, resulting in reduced classroom interaction and lower exam performance, particularly within rural and underserved regions where the impact is most severe.

The Impact on Rajasthan's Educational Ecosystem

  • Heavy Workload: Teachers are managing extra subjects, administrative duties, and co-curricular responsibilities.
  • Declining Quality: With fewer staff, personalized attention to students is decreasing, affecting learning outcomes.
  • Unequal Distribution: Urban schools are relatively better staffed than rural ones, deepening the educational divide.
  • Administrative Delays: Vacant non-teaching posts are causing delays in record management and institutional functioning.
